摘要
本文提出了一种智能式局部放电测试系统。本系统具有自检、干扰采集、数据采集、串行通信等11种功能。该系统采用模块化结构,主机模板由MCS—96系列8098单片机组成,用于完成数字信号的采集和处理;输入模板用于接收模拟信号和模拟信号的放大、采样保持、模数转换;键盘显示模块主要完成某些数据的显示;模块连接板主要的功能是将各个模板有机的连接起来,便于系统的安装与调试;软件模块包括监控程序和功能程序两部分,监控程序主要功能是管理键盘、显示器、I/O口、调用和运行用户程序等,功能程序列用来完成数据采集、干扰信号的采集和串行通信等;本文提出了三种抗干扰措施:采用交流稳压器以防止电源系统的过压与欠压,采用隔离变压器抗共模干扰,采用高抗干扰直流稳压电源抗电源干扰。我们用脉冲发生器做一个模拟实验。实验对象为10KHZ的脉冲,在不同的幅值下采集1秒,所得实验数据表明系统能够分辨10kHZ的脉冲,对脉冲的分辨率达到了100μs,满足系统要求。
in this paper ,intelligent partial discharge test system is put forward. The system has eleven kinds of functions, such as automatic check interference sampling ,data sampling , serial communication and so on. The system which is a modular structure adopts 8098 single chip computer of MCS-96 family as the main form board in order to finish sampling and disposing digital signal. Among the modulars, input modular is used for accepting analogue signal, sampling holding and D/A converter. Keyboard and display modular is used for displaying some data. All the modulars will be connected by modular connection board in order to set up and debug the system. In addition, software modular consists of monitor program which can administrate keyboard, displayer, I/O port, debug and run user' s program and function program which can sample data and disturbing signal and communicate serial data. Besides that, three kinds of anti ?interference ways are put forward, namely, first, the AC sta-blilizator is adopted in order to prevent the system from creating overvoltage and undertension. Second, the insulating transformer is used in order to resist common mode disturbing. Third, the DC stabilizator is used as resisting power supply disturbing. At the end of paper, the brief introduction of the test result will be given.
